Pune Railway Station is an important elevated metro station on the East-West corridor of the Aqua Line of Pune Metro in Pune, India, which holds the main Pune Junction railway station. The station was opened on 1 August 2023 as an extension of Pune Metro Phase I. Aqua Line operates between Vanaz and Ramwadi.
